Для изменения размера нажмите или перетащите

MetaRoleDmlQueryExecutor - класс

Выполняет построение DML-команд для SQL Server, изменяющих состав списка метаролей.
Иерархия наследования
SystemObject
  Tessa.RolesMetaRoleDmlQueryExecutor

Пространство имён:  Tessa.Roles
Сборка:  Tessa (в Tessa.dll) Версия: 3.5.0.19
Синтаксис
public sealed class MetaRoleDmlQueryExecutor

Тип MetaRoleDmlQueryExecutor предоставляет следующие члены.

Конструкторы
  ИмяОписание
Открытый методMetaRoleDmlQueryExecutor(Guid, String)
Создаёт экземпляр объекта с указанием идентификатора типа карточки метароли. Для изменяемых метаролей указывается, что изменения произвела система.
Открытый методMetaRoleDmlQueryExecutor(Guid, String, Guid, String)
Создаёт экземпляр объекта с указанием идентификатора типа карточки метароли, а также идентификатора и имени пользователя, изменившего метароли.
В начало страницы
Свойства
  ИмяОписание
Открытое свойствоCardTypeCaption
Отображаемое имя карточки метароли, используемое при добавлении записей о метаролях в таблицу [Instances].
Открытое свойствоCardTypeID
Тип карточки метароли, используемый при добавлении записей о метаролях в таблицу [Instances].
Открытое свойствоItemsToDelete
Коллекция ролей, которые должны быть удалены.
Открытое свойствоItemsToInsert
Коллекция ролей, которые должны быть добавлены.
Открытое свойствоItemsToUpdate
Коллекция ролей, которые должны быть обновлены.
Открытое свойствоModifiedByID
Идентификатор пользователя, изменяющего метароли.
Открытое свойствоModifiedByName
Имя пользователя, изменяющего метароли.
В начало страницы
Методы
  ИмяОписание
Открытый методAddForDelete
Добавляет метароль к списку удаляемых метаролей.
Открытый методAddForInsert
Добавляет метароль к списку создаваемых метаролей.
Открытый методAddForUpdate
Добавляет метароль к списку обновляемых метаролей.
Открытый методEquals
Determines whether the specified object is equal to the current object.
(Унаследован от Object.)
Открытый методExecuteDeleteAsync
Создаёт и выполняет SQL-команды, удаляющие метароли.
Открытый методExecuteInsertAndUpdateAsync
Создаёт и выполняет SQL-команды, добавляющие метароли или выполняющие их изменение.
Защищённый методFinalize
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ection.
(Унаследован от Object.)
Открытый методGetHashCode
Serves as the default hash function.
(Унаследован от Object.)
Открытый методGetType
Gets the Type of the current instance.
(Унаследован от Object.)
Открытый методHasDeleteData
Определяет, содержит ли объект информацию, для которой будут созданы SQL-запросы посредством вызова метода ExecuteDeleteAsync(TransactionQueryExecutor, IQueryBuilderFactory, CancellationToken).
Открытый методHasInsertOrUpdateData
Определяет, содержит ли объект информацию, для которой будут созданы SQL-запросы посредством вызова метода ExecuteInsertAndUpdateAsync(IDbScope, CancellationToken).
Защищённый методMemberwiseClone
Creates a shallow copy of the current Object.
(Унаследован от Object.)
Открытый методToString
Returns a string that represents the current object.
(Унаследован от Object.)
В начало страницы
Методы расширения
  ИмяОписание
Открытый метод расширенияGet (Определяется ComHelper.)
Открытый метод расширенияInternalMarkerCanvas
Возвращает маркер аннотации
(Определяется AnnotationInternalsAccessor.)
Открытый метод расширенияInvoke (Определяется ComHelper.)
Открытый метод расширенияSet (Определяется ComHelper.)
В начало страницы
Заметки
DML - Data Manipulation Language; это подмножество языка SQL, которое включает команды INSERT, UPDATE и DELETE.
См. также